How Air Breather Filters Work
Air breather filters, also known as crankcase ventilation filters, serve a crucial function in regulating the air pressure within the engine’s crankcase. This system ensures that harmful gases created during the combustion process do not build up, which can lead to increased pressure and potential engine damage. The air breather filter allows for the exchange of clean air while filtering out contaminants that could cause wear on engine components.
The operation of these filters is based on the principle of separation and filtration. As air enters the crankcase, it draws in the oil vapors and gases. The breather filter then acts as a barrier, allowing only clean air to re-enter the engine while trapping dirt, dust, and other particulate matter. This maintains a cleaner environment within the engine, which is essential for optimal performance and longevity.
When these filters become clogged or ineffective, engine performance can suffer as pressure builds up and harmful gases are allowed back into the system. This emphasizes the need for regularly inspecting and replacing air breather filters to ensure they function correctly and contribute positively to the engine’s overall health.
Common Issues with Air Breather Filters
Despite their critical function, air breather filters can encounter several common issues that may affect their efficiency. One of the primary problems is clogging due to dirt and contaminants. As these filters collect more debris over time, their airflow capacity decreases, which can lead to increased pressure in the crankcase. This can cause oil leaks, excessive oil consumption, and even engine damage if left unaddressed.
Another issue is improper installation or fitment. If an air breather filter is not installed according to the manufacturer’s specifications, it may not seal correctly, allowing unfiltered air to enter the crankcase. This can introduce a multitude of contaminants that can degrade engine oil and increase wear on internal components. Therefore, ensuring proper installation is vital for maintaining the health of your vehicle.
Lastly, environmental factors can also affect air breather filter performance. For example, operating in dusty or off-road conditions requires more frequent replacement of filters due to the increased load of particulate matter. Awareness of these common issues can help car owners take proactive measures, ensuring their air breather filters are always functioning optimally.
Maintenance Tips for Air Breather Filters
Maintaining air breather filters is essential for ensuring that your vehicle’s engine runs smoothly. Regular inspection is a straightforward yet critical practice. It’s advised to check the filters at regular intervals, particularly during oil changes. Look for signs of dirt accumulation, discoloration, or physical damage. If the filters appear clogged or damaged, replace them immediately to prevent any adverse effects on engine performance.
Cleaning reusable oil-bath style filters can extend their lifespan and maintain efficient operation. This process usually involves removing the filter, soaking it in a suitable cleaning solution, and allowing it to dry completely before reinstallation. This method can often be repeated several times before the need for replacement arises, thus offering a cost-effective maintenance strategy.
It is also beneficial to pay attention to the driving environment. If you frequently drive in conditions with high dust levels or stop-and-go traffic, consider checking the filters more regularly as these conditions can cause filters to clog more quickly. Furthermore, following the manufacturer’s recommendations regarding filter replacement intervals is crucial in ensuring reliable performance and safeguarding your engine’s health.

1. Type of Filter
The first factor to consider when selecting an air car breather filter is the type of filter you require. There are generally three types: paper filters, foam filters, and cotton filters. Paper filters are the most common and are disposable, providing good filtration but needing replacement regularly. Foam filters offer better airflow and can often be cleaned and reused, making them a more environmentally friendly option. Cotton filters, often made from oiled materials, tend to provide excellent filtration while allowing for higher airflow, which can improve engine performance.
Choosing the right type of filter depends on your driving style and vehicle use. For instance, if you frequently drive in dusty conditions, a foam filter might be more effective due to its superior dirt retention capacity. Conversely, if you drive your car primarily for commuting and prefer a maintenance-free option, a paper filter may suffice. Understanding the advantages and disadvantages of each filter type is vital to making an informed decision.
